1

Work with a certified roofing contractor to guarantee a safe and professionally installed roof.

News Discuss 
Discover the Different Sorts Of Roof Covering Provider Available for Your Home Navigating the extensive realm of household roof covering can be a difficult job for home owners. With a wide variety of alternatives encompassing asphalt shingles, metal, slate, tile, and even eco-friendly and solar options, each offering special benefits, https://goodroofing24208.fare-blog.com/34209784/quality-roof-replacement-services-can-extend-the-lifespan-of-your-home-and-improve-energy-efficiency

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story